Note, this thread is pure speculation and does not indicate any specific upcoming content.

Sacred Seals have been somewhat interesting since their inception in April last year, starting out as simple stat boosts and slowly expanding to include special skills exclusive to Sacred Seals (Quickened Pulse was the first), Fortify and Spur skills, and at some point Sacred Seals simply became "flexible Passive Skills". They only later gained the ability to be upgraded to have stronger, or more accurately "max level", effects via the Sacred Seal forge, as well as gaining access to crafting old Sacred Seals we may have missed and a few new seals.

There are now more than 60 unique player available Sacred Seals available to us, and only some of them are skills unique to Sacred Seals (though some are available as effects on personal weapons and personal skills), and with each Tempest Trial and Squad Assault, the number steadily grows. Of course that number is mostly padded out by the variations of stat boosting skills...

Sacred Seals, for a while, have followed a pretty standard pattern: To qualify for being a Sacred Seal, be a Passive skill that is considered "unpopular" compared to the other options available in that skills passives category, such as Seal Spd in Passive B. There have been some cases of popular skills becoming Sacred Seals, such as Quick Riposte, and some Sacred Seals enabled some level of popularity towards a skill, such as Brash Assault when paired with Desperation.

I don't want to say that some skills have no hope of ever becoming Sacred Seals, but it also seems like some skills would be considered too powerful as Sacred Seals, such as the Battle Initiation skills (imagine, Death Blow 6 with Siegberts Dark Greatsword...), and others have simply been forgotten as time went on (whatever happened to the Defiant skills?). Even excluding those skills, there are still a number of skills to translate to Sacred Seals, especially if interesting effects such as the Def/Res Link or Odd Wave skills are just being brought into the light.

There's also the potential of weapon effects becoming Sacred Seals still, such as the Owltome effect or effectiveness towards certain units. While I've no idea what the expected lifespan of FEH is supposed to be, there's still quite the interesting future for Sacred Seals...

One Sacred Seal I would love to have is Live to Serve. There are 3 skill which are essential for any staff user build: Wrathful Staff, Dazzling Staff and Live to Serve. The first two are available in the Weapon Refinery, and all 3 skills are B-slot skills. Having Live to Serve SS, a healer will be able to do normal damage, prevent foe's counterattack and be able to heal themselves by healing allies. And like Quick Riposte 3, Live to Serve 3 is a 5-stars exclusive, so having it in seal form would be interesting. Also, only 2 units have Live to Serve: Elise and Wrys.
